New Vision Digital Marketing Company in Delhi, Gurgaon, Noida, India
4 weeks ago
Report as inaccurate
ID: #286854
Listing Categories : Advertising, Information Technology, Internet
New Vision Digital Marketing Services Company in Gurgaon, Delhi, Noida, India helps you establish a foothold on the online medium for both Search Engines and Social Media. http://newvision.digital/digital-marketing-company-gurgaon
Add Your Review
Please login to add your review.